  • Various shots of Lxd2 locos on the Tuczno sugar factory line on 8 November 2001:
    1. Train of empty wagons arriving at Przybranowo. Shortly after this, while the loco was shunting across the level crossing, a car ran into the side of it.
    2. (1:22) A brief view of the loading pad at Przybranowo.
    3. (1:33) Loaded train headed towards Tuczno at Zelechin, west of Rojewo.
    4. (1:56) The same train at Liszkow - I got a better shot here in 2002.
    5. (4:02) Another loaded train between Osniszczewo and Zagajewice.
    6. (5:00) A loaded train at (I think) Wierzbiczany, just east of Wierzchoslawice - this gives a good idea of the speed at which the Tuczno trains ran.
    7. (7:09) Another fast-moving loaded train, I think this is at Rojewo.
    8. (7:46) Loaded train at Niszczewice, between Liszkowo and Tuczno - this became a favourite spot.
    9. (10:08) Loaded train leaving Przybranowo. In the background another loco beside the mountain of beet.
    10. (10:49) Probably the same train, at Opoki. See how the train slows as the steep grade and tight double bend have their effect, and the engine note changes.
    11. (12:56) Another loaded train at Opoki, taken from lower down the slope and almost darkness - I switched to infra red at the end of the clip.
    We never found out just what time of day the Tuczno line stopped running, but I believe they carried around 100,000t of beet in a season of less than three months.

      Sadly not, the railway was last used for the 2002 sugar campaign and then the track was dismantled and the locomotives sold off in 2003; the sugar factory itself subsequently closed.
      There are now no sugar factory railways left in Poland - the last were Kruszwica and Tuczno in the 2002 campaign.
      There are also now no common carrier narrow gauge freight operations in Poland - I think the last was probably the Zbiersk system which stopped carrying freight in 2010 or 2011.
